Sexual inhibition

A sexual inhibition denotes a conservative attitude to or a reservation relating to specific sexual practises.

One might be defined as having high sexual inhibitions in the events of fearing (see erotophobia) or being repelled by any sexual practise or discourse. Alternatively, one might have low sexual inhibitions by unashamedly welcoming a variety of erotic techniques.

A particularly uninhibited individual might be branded in contemporary society as being a slut, stud or pervert while someone abnormally inhibited may be considered sexually frigid .
